South Island Pied Oystercatcher (SIPO) in SE Queensland

Just received a call from Paul Walbridge advising that there was a SIPO at Point Halloran this morning. Brian Russell found it two weeks ago but wasn’t then entirely confident of the ID. They now have numerous photos. It was with 80 OZPO’s of NSW and SE Qld origin. Apparently the waders assemble there on a rising tide but then move on if the tide height is greater than 1.8 m as it was this morning
